The phrase "and finally becoming a"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when describing a progression or culmination of events leading to a specific role or status. Example: "After years of hard work and dedication, she achieved her dream of becoming a doctor, and finally becoming a respected member of the medical community."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
Use "and finally becoming a" to clearly indicate the culmination of a process or series of events leading to a defined status or role. This phrase effectively conveys a sense of completion and transformation.
Common error
Avoid using "and finally becoming a" too frequently in a single passage, as it can make your writing sound repetitive. Instead, vary your language by using synonyms like "and ultimately becoming a" or "and eventually becoming a" to maintain reader engagement.

FAQs
How can I rephrase "and finally becoming a" to sound more formal?
For a more formal tone, you might consider using phrases such as "and subsequently becoming a", "and thereafter evolving into a", or "and ultimately culminating in a".
Is there a difference in meaning between "and finally becoming a" and "and eventually becoming a"?
While both phrases indicate a transformation over time, "and finally becoming a" suggests a sense of completion or the end of a process, whereas "and eventually becoming a" simply implies that something happened at some point without a strong emphasis on completion.
Can "and finally becoming a" be used in all types of writing?
The phrase "and finally becoming a" is versatile and can be used in various types of writing, from news articles to formal reports. However, consider the tone and context to ensure it fits appropriately. More formal alternatives might be preferable in certain academic or professional settings.
What are some common synonyms for "finally" in the phrase "and finally becoming a"?
Common synonyms for "finally" in this context include "at last", "eventually", "ultimately", and "subsequently". Each offers a slightly different nuance, allowing you to tailor the phrase to your specific meaning. For example, using "and ultimately becoming a" can emphasize the end result.
